- The distance between Lugansk, Ukraine and Yellowstone Park, Wyoming, Usa is approximately 9,212 km or 5,724 mi.
- To reach Lugansk in this distance one would set out from Yellowstone Park, Wyoming bearing 19.5° or NNE and follow the great circles arc to approach Lugansk bearing 159.1° or SSE .
- Both have a warm summer continental/ hemiboreal climate with no dry season (Dfb).
- Lugansk is in or near the cool temperate moist forest biome whereas Yellowstone Park, Wyoming is in or near the boreal moist forest biome.
- The mean annual temperature is 4.2 °C (7.5°F) warmer.
- Average monthly temperatures vary by 3.1 °C (5.6°F) more in Lugansk. The continentality subtype is subcontinental for both.
- Total annual precipitation averages 85 mm (3.3 in) more which is equivalent to 85 l/m² (2.09 US gal/ft²) or 850,000 l/ha (90,871 US gal/ac) more. About 1 2/9 as much.
- The altitude of the sun at midday is overall 3.5° lower in Lugansk than in Yellowstone Park, Wyoming.
